    You can't. Your body dictates where fat is lost and there's no way to deter it from happening with any exercise technique or workout. There also aren't any exercise techniques that firm up breasts since you can't train fat.
    So options are, stay at a higher body fat level to keep them, lose weight and probably lose them, or plastic surgery to enhance them.
